Rapid Reaction: Central Michigan 82, Bowling Green 76


After a historic 50-point performance in a victory over Ball State on Saturday, Marcus Keene and the Central Michigan men's basketball team returned to McGuirk Arena Tuesday to face-off against Bowling Green. 

The Chippewas (13-7, 3-4 Mid-American Conference) defeated the Falcons 82-76 to win their second straight game MAC game. 

It was once again the Keene and Braylon Rayson show Tuesday, as the duo combined for 55 points. Rayson shot 10-of-23 from the field, while Keene shot 7-of-20. 

The Chippewas led 42-30 at the half, but saw their lead dwindle down to 5 with a minute remaining. A lay-up by Rayson with 54 seconds left gave CMU some cushion and junior Cecil Williams grabbed a rebound the next possession to send the Chippewas to the free throw line and put the game away. 

What's Next

Central Michigan travels to Kent, Ohio on Saturday to play the Golden Flashes. Tip-off is scheduled for noon.
